React ref vs forwardref
Web'forwardRef requires a render function but was given %s.', render === null? 'null': typeof render,);} else {// 如果对应组件的入参只有一个或者超出两个则抛出错误,正常 forwardRef 的组件应该有两个入参 (props, ref) warningWithoutStack WebApr 10, 2024 · なぜスニペットを自作した方がいいのか. これ以降はJavaScript, TypeScript, React.jsの前提とします。. 他言語の場合は当てはまらない可能性があります。. 1. 拡張 …
React ref vs forwardref
Did you know?
WebJun 6, 2024 · import * as React from "react"; import ReactDOM from "react-dom"; const Component = React.forwardRef ( (props, ref) => { React.useEffect ( () => { const node = ref.current; const listen = (): void => console.log ("foo"); if (node) { node.addEventListener ("mouseover", listen); } return () => { node.removeEventListener ("mouseover", listen); }; }, … WebApr 11, 2024 · 在编写高阶组件时, forwardRef 能确保 ref 对象被正确的传递到被包装的组件中。. React 中的 forwardRef 是一个非常重要的 API,因为它能帮我们处理一些特殊场景,比如文中提到的访问子组件的 DOM 节点或者用于编写高阶组件。. 通过使用 forwardRef API,我们能更加方便 ...
WebApr 11, 2024 · 在编写高阶组件时, forwardRef 能确保 ref 对象被正确的传递到被包装的组件中。. React 中的 forwardRef 是一个非常重要的 API,因为它能帮我们处理一些特殊场 … WebApr 6, 2024 · forwardRef () is a higher-order component that wraps a React component. The wrapped component works same way as the original component but also receives as the …
WebApr 6, 2024 · Let's follow React's advice and see how forwardRef() can help. 2. forwardRef() Now is the right moment to introduce forwardRef(). forwardRef() is a higher-order component that wraps a React component. The wrapped component works the same way as the original component but also receives as the second parameter a ref: the forwarded … WebOct 8, 2024 · Refs: Component mutations in React without state Refs in React give us a means of storing mutable values throughout a component’s lifecycle, and are often used for interacting with the DOM...
WebWhen you pass a DOM component to Waypoint, it handles getting a reference to the DOM node through the ref prop automatically. If you pass a composite component, you can wrap it with React.forwardRef (requires react@^16.3.0) and have the ref prop being handled automatically for you, like this: class Block extends React.
WebSection 1: Setup TypeScript with React Prerequisites You can use this cheatsheet for reference at any skill level, but basic understanding of React and TypeScript is assumed. Here is a list of prerequisites: Good understanding of React. Familiarity with TypeScript Basics and Everyday Types. gbh new presidentWebFeb 23, 2024 · Using React refs Focus control Detect if an element is contained Integrating with DOM-based libraries When should you use the useRef Hook? Avoiding React ref anti-patterns Using forwardRef Creating refs When working with class-based components in the past, we used createRef() to create a ref. gbho bemWebref 。我们非常支持这一改变,因为这将使 forwardRef 变得多余。 我可以问一个额外的问题:在“Preact 10”的第一个alpha现在出来之后,我已经看到——正如您在上面所写的那样——它没有 forwardRef 函数,而属性 键 不再是道具的一部分。但是,property ref days inn hotel atlantaWebApr 15, 2024 · React Forward Ref is an invaluable tool for handling references to DOM elements and child components within your Next.js applications. It simplifies component logic, improves code organization ... gbh new cross innWebApr 10, 2024 · "forwardRef": { "scope": "typescript,typescriptreact", "prefix": "fwd", "body": [ "const $1 = React.forwardRef ( (props, ref) => {", " const {} = props;", "", " return", "});", "", "$1.displayName = '$1';" ] }, "forwardRef (extend style)": { "scope": "typescript,typescriptreact", "prefix": "fwds", "body": [ "type $1Props = … gbhofWebTo help you get started, we’ve selected a few react-is exam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source … days inn hotel breakfast hoursWeb'forwardRef requires a render function but was given %s.', render === null? 'null': typeof render,);} else {// 如果对应组件的入参只有一个或者超出两个则抛出错误,正常 forwardRef … gbh merch